About Barangay Obrero
Situated in Quezon City, Barangay Obrero is one of 142 barangays that make up the city within NCR.
Detailed 2020 population figures for Barangay Obrero are being compiled from Philippine Statistics Authority census tables. For context, the city of Quezon City contains 142 barangays in total.
Quezon City is a city comprising 142 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Obrero,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ration.
Like every Philippine barangay, Barangay Obrero is led by an elected Punong Barangay (barangay captain) supported by seven Sangguniang Barangay members (kagawads), an SK Chairperson, a Barangay Secretary, and a Barangay Treasurer. The next Barangay and Sangguniang Kabataan Elections (BSKE) are scheduled for Monday, November 2, 2026, with officials serving four-year terms under Republic Act No. 12232.
